Brian's father is 4 times as old as Jason. After 5 years his father will be 3 times as old as Jason. What are their present ages?​

Given

Brian's father is 4 times as old as Jason

After 5 years he will be 3 times as old as Jason

To Find

Present ages of Jason and Brian's father

Let us assume that Jason's age be 'x' years

then, according to the question

Brian's father age =>4×x =4x

After 5 years Jason's age will be 'x+5' years

His father age after 5 years=>4x+5

According to the question

After 5 years his father will be 3 times as old as Jason

=>4x+5=3(x+5)

=>4x+5=3x+15

=>4x-3x=15-5

=>x=10

Therefore, Jason's age is 10 years

Brian's father age is 10×4=40 years
